The Golden Nugget in Laughlin fired up a promo for May and June. It
resembles ones that have been done in the past. Drawings on
Saturdays with a Big Bang on the last Saturday. Cruises or cash are
the prizes.
The drawing tickets are fairly hard to get, which I like, none for
eating, sleeping or breathing.
A $25 suited BJ for table games.
A $100 hit on .25, .50 and $1 VP.
Similiar frequencies for slots.
